    Addressing Common Pigging Concerns

    Handling usual pigging challenges typically demands a planned plan. At first, validate that the implement is appropriately calibrated for the pipe system. Furthermore, scrutinize the feed point and retrieval point for any impediments. A usual matter is line clearing deterioration caused by extreme pressure; hence confirm that active controls remain within acceptable extents. Eventually, gauge degradation on the tool’s segments, principally the cups, as this may imply the necessity for exchange.

    Lowering Pipeline Maintenance Costs with Pigging Operations

    Effectively diminishing pipeline management costs is a paramount objective for countless oil and gas corporations. A reliable method for accomplishing this is the application of pigging solutions. These technological cleaning systems, or “pigs,” transit through the duct, clearing buildup, rust, and other interferences that can restrict flow output and cause high-priced repairs. Periodic pigging initiatives can preemptively tackle these concerns, prolonging the duration of the pipeline and curtailing the demand for extensive and exacting steps.

    • Boosts flow efficiency.
    • Diminishes oxidation.
    • Lengthens flowline work life.
